At this point, volatility is considered part and parcel of the yet evolving cryptocurrency landscape, leaving the number of “stable token” options for investors quite low. To help reshape this narrative, the idea of ‘hourglass tokens’ has emerged, offering what many consider safe investments in cryptocurrency — primarily via the introduction of mathematical certainty that eliminates any guesswork. To understand how hourglass tokens work requires examining their fundamental principle as their price calculation is based purely on the relationship between the total balance held in the contract and the circulating supply. This formula — expressed as USDT ÷ Circulating Supply — creates a pricing structure where each purchase automatically increases the token's value floor. Unlike traditional cryptocurrencies that rely on market sentiment and external trading activity, hourglass tokens operate on transparent mathematical principles that anyone can verify (since they operate atop the blockchain), making them tokens with consistent growth potential. A deeper dive into the model’s pervading mechanics The beauty of this system lies in its inherent stability such that when investors purchase tokens, they are required to contribute to the USDT reserve while simultaneously increasing the circulating supply, but the net effect consistently pushes the price upward. When positions are closed through the automatic selling mechanism, tokens are permanently burned from circulation, maintaining the mathematical integrity of the pricing formula.
